Transaction 2166946ef07c73bcf3f058d79b331b151f34b636c1cae7ca84d6aef08a52cfda

1 Input
2 Outputs
  • 2166946ef07c73bcf3f058d79b331b151f34b636c1cae7ca84d6aef08a52cfda:0
  • value  1007642382
    address  mo16cpn5QLchgSd2p7ksD5APyzQp2r1yds
  • 2166946ef07c73bcf3f058d79b331b151f34b636c1cae7ca84d6aef08a52cfda:1
  • value  107421
    address  n2besm1cKnuNwLt28m2QKqc3gE71A6vqwG